netting back strand tramore

Post by chris on Tue Feb 10, 2009 5:48 am

i was down at the back strand in tramore at low tide,today.collecting bait and came across a 40 foot net set in the channel.phoned the guards,got the baliffs numder,they gave me the wrong one.they werent much help.so i pulled it out and left on the bank.
